There are several ways to have flickering LED's.
Flickering LED's or standard LED's controlled by a flicker unit.
I've had a look around for very small 1.3mm flickering LED's but can only find them in 3mm on a well know auction site (not sure if I'm allowed to use the name).
I have found two very small flicker controls on the same site, one for a single LED and the other controls four but I should think a couple of extra LED's could be added to each unit.
LED range in size from about 1.3mm upwards and most come with a resistor.
